Abstract This paper intends to elucidate the similarities between smart city development and big data analytics adoption. Both concepts promise new opportunities: smart cities to improve citizens' life quality and big data analytics to drive companies towards the competitive edge. Consequently, the number of organisational big data initiatives and efforts to implement smart city concepts are increasing. In the context of big data analytics adoption, it could be shown that there are two distinct approaches companies follow. They either focus on the search for potential use cases or on the development of a technology infrastructure. Based on a comparison of various smart city and big data analytics use cases, this paper discloses that both of these approaches either concentrate on developing new service development or providing the required infrastructures for future services.
